I would blame three men. Bockrath, Bow Tie Andy, and Joab Thomas. Thomas started it when he tried to de-emphasize football in the 80s. He's the reason Bowden turned the job down in 1987. Things worked out, getting Stallings in 1990. But then Bockrath ran him off, like you said. Sorensen nearly finished Alabama football off. Thank God he left for South Carolina in 2002.
